What Do Dental Implants Look Like?

Dental implants are becoming increasingly popular as a solution for missing or damaged teeth. But what do dental implants look like? This comprehensive guide provides an insight into their appearance and function, covering the components, materials, aesthetics, and more.

The Components of Dental Implants

Implant Fixture

The implant fixture is the base component surgically inserted into the jawbone. Made of titanium, it acts as an artificial root that supports the rest of the implant structure. It integrates with the bone, providing stability and strength.

Abutment

The abutment is a connector that attaches to the implant fixture. It provides a base for the prosthetic crown and is typically made of titanium, stainless steel, or ceramic materials.

Prosthetic Crown

The prosthetic crown is the visible part of the implant. Designed to match the appearance of natural teeth, it is usually made of porcelain or ceramic and is customized in terms of shape, size, and color.

Implant Materials and Their Aesthetic Appeal

Ceramic Implants

Ceramic implants are known for their natural appearance. Being white and translucent, they closely mimic natural teeth and are highly resistant to wear and staining.

Zirconia Implants

Zirconia is a crystalline material known for its durability. It offers a metal-free option with a color closely resembling natural teeth, making it a popular choice.

Titanium Implants

Titanium is a well-known material for its biocompatibility and strength. Titanium implants are corrosion-resistant and provide a robust foundation for the rest of the implant.

Los Algodones Dental Tourism

dental tourism

Affordable Quality Dental Treatments for Americans and Canadians

Los Algodones is a small Mexican town located at the California – Arizona border. It is the northernmost town in Mexico. Los Algodones has become a popular tourist attraction in recent years due to its inexpensive shopping and restaurants as well as inexpensive dental, medical care and prescription medicines.
